  • Abstract
    Since April 2008, a "digital inclusion" research cluster gathering researchers and professional practitioners from British universities and industry has focused on discussing and developing methodologies to increase the accessibility of digital systems to "digitally disenfranchised groups", including special needs and elderly users. We here report on the Ontologies and Interactive Systems international workshop (Ontoract\´08), which was held as a related activity to this initiative. The workshop gathered experts and researchers who discussed their respective expertise and exchanged their experiences of using knowledge-based methodologies and techniques to solve complex HCI and interaction design issues. Of particular interest were solutions designed to address the challenges of inclusion for all in the digital society.
